About Min Wan
Min Wan is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Artificial Intelligence, Computer Networks and Communications, Computational Theory and Mathematics and Signal Processing, having authored 30 papers that have together received 920 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Computational Geometry and Mesh Generation (3 papers), Formal Methods in Verification (3 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(3 papers), Image Retrieval and Classification Techniques (3 papers),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(3 papers), Advanced Text Analysis Techniques (3 papers), Image Processing Techniques and Applications (2 papers) and Robotic Path Planning Algorithms (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Water Science and Technology (139 citations), Environmental Engineering (102 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(137 citations), Global and Planetary Change (119 citations) and Computational Theory and Mathematics (78 citations). Min Wan has collaborated with scholars based in China, Singapore and United States. Frequent co-authors include Xiang‐Jun Shen, Jianping Gou, Lan Du, Yongzhao Zhan, Jinfu Chen, Zhao Zhang, Kieran M. O’Connor, Lihua Xiong, Yu Wang and Desheng Wang. Their work appears in journals such as ACM SIGMETRICS Performance Evaluation Review, Hydrological Sciences Journal, Alexandria Engineering Journal, Journal of Digital Imaging and Performance Evaluation.
